Originally Posted By: Clem
OK, I'm curious.

Do you train a deer-tracking dog the same way as bird dogs? Scent trails, put them with experienced dogs, etc?



Yes, you can. Mine are professionally trained to hunt birds. They know to hunt 'dead' for scent. My female can sniff out a rat in a hayfield. She has a great nose.

I started mine as a puppy letting him chew on deer hangin in the cooler. He figured out what a deer looked and smelled like real early. Then when he got older, I started putting him on deer that I knew were down and let him find them. It's real easy to do if the dog likes doing it.
